SBD: Bockor Bellegems Bruin.
A west flanders ale (flanders oud bruin says ba.com). This was alot better than i expected given the cheesy logo. Cherries and musty-ness in the nose. Taste of sour cherries, slight green apple, and some earthy-woody flavor. All in all a solid sour(ish) beer.

TBD: Green Flash Rayon Vert.
Half a glass down and i still not sure if i love it or hate it. It is a very unique beer. I cant think of anything ive tried which i can compare it to. A couple different spices and im assuming theres brett in this.
eta:
As it warms im enjoying it more, like many belgians which start out questionable to me.
